Details
-
Bug
-
Resolution: Done
-
P2: Important
-
unversioned
-
None
-
a6ad86915506a2b42a42143f0a7f621c77b45a77
Description
During handling of the above exception, another exception occurred:
Traceback (most recent call last):
File "/home/akeskimo/qt-ci-master/src/platform_configurations.py", line 447, in <module>
configs = builder.get_configurations(integrationRequest, product)
File "/home/akeskimo/qt-ci-master/src/platform_configurations.py", line 283, in get_configurations
configs = platforms_for_project_and_branch(integrationRequest.repositoryState, product, integrationRequest.productVersion)
File "/home/akeskimo/qt-ci-master/src/platform_configurations.py", line 241, in platforms_for_project_and_branch
with application.instance.connectToSourceStorageService() as storage:
File "/home/akeskimo/qt-ci-master/src/application.py", line 319, in connectToSourceStorageService
return typing.cast(RPCContext[sourcestorage.SourceStorage], self.connectToServiceGeneric("SourceStorage"))
File "/home/akeskimo/qt-ci-master/src/application.py", line 303, in connectToServiceGeneric
address = self.getServiceInfo(name)
File "/home/akeskimo/qt-ci-master/src/application.py", line 333, in getServiceInfo
with self.connectToNameService() as nameService:
File "/opt/python-3.5.2/lib/python3.5/contextlib.py", line 59, in _enter_
return next(self.gen)
File "/home/akeskimo/qt-ci-master/env/lib/python3.5/site-packages/thriftpy/rpc.py", line 74, in client_context
transport.open()
File "/home/akeskimo/qt-ci-master/env/lib/python3.5/site-packages/thriftpy/transport/transport.py", line 113, in open
return self.__trans.open()
File "/home/akeskimo/qt-ci-master/env/lib/python3.5/site-packages/thriftpy/transport/socket.py", line 82, in open
message=message)
thriftpy.transport.transport.TTransportException: TTransportException(type=1, message='Could not connect to localhost:48545')
Traceback (most recent call last):
File "/home/akeskimo/qt-ci-master/env/lib/python3.5/site-packages/thriftpy/transport/socket.py", line 74, in open
raise e
File "/home/akeskimo/qt-ci-master/env/lib/python3.5/site-packages/thriftpy/transport/socket.py", line 69, in open
self.handle.connect(res[4])
ConnectionRefusedError: [Errno 111] Connection refused
Reproduce:
1) cherry pick a commit that changes platform instructions
2) terminate any existing coin session
3) run src/test_platformconfigurations.py --generate
Work-around:
./run_ci --tmux-no-attach
src/test_platformconfigurations.py --generate